Muse’s Devon eco house for sale
Friday, October 23rd, 2009A rock band living in an eco home, did I hear that right? Yes you did and the band in question are the multi award-winning Muse.
The eco home where the three British musicians have been renting near Teignmouth in Devon is now for sale at a rock and rolling £1.35 million.
The 5 bedroom timber and glass framed house is set in its own private wooded valley, the perfect place to strum out some electric sounds without upsetting the neighbours.
The exposed laminated timber beams and roof covered in golden cedar shingles will, say the designers, lock in hundreds of tonnes of carbon for the life of the building.
And the taps won’t be left on in this eco home as a rain water harvesting system ensures that drinking water is only used where it is needed.

New Apprentice House Revealed
Friday, October 16th, 2009Another batch of Apprentice hopefuls will be back on our screens in March 2010, fighting it out to work for Sir, sorry, Lord Alan Sugar.
This is the Bloomsbury house that they will be staying in as they battle to win the six figure salary.
The swanky, 8 bed, £11.25 million Bedford Square property comes with three grand reception rooms, a family room and a media room.
The house was bought in 2006 and has undergone a £3.5 million lavish renovation that includes four £30,000 fireplaces, Parquet de Versailles flooring, and the piece de resistance, an indoor pool complete with spa and gym.
Lord Sugar’s potential employees will find a mix of sharp modern styles and traditional Georgian designs throughout the interior of the house.
The handmade Italian kitchen has a crescent shaped bar with blue lighting underneath, perfect for partying or entertaining. Sounds more like a holiday than the toughest job interview they’ll ever have.
Jade Jagger can’t get no satisfaction selling her property
Wednesday, September 23rd, 2009This chic three bedroom property in London, owned by the socialite Jade Jagger, has been on the market for about a year now. Has the reason it’s not selling got anything to do with the gold stripper pole that’s slap bang in the middle of the bathroom…?
The £1.5 million property is located on Keslake Road, Queen’s Park, where neighbours are reported to include the actor Daniel Craig and pop singer Lilly Allen – surely that’s a good enough reason to move in?
Heather Mills’ London apartment for sale
Friday, September 18th, 2009The infamous Heather Mills, a certain Beatle member’s ex, has put her swanky London apartment on the billionaire’s row, The Bishops Avenue, up for sale.
Reported to have spent up £15 million on properties, holidays and staff wages, could this be a sign of Heather being affected by the recession?
Mills snapped up the three bedroom home for around £2.35 million at the end of last year and now it’s on the market for £3.75 million. Complete with indoor pool and gym, it would certainly be a great place to unwind after a hard day’s night.
Mills still has a home in Sussex and apartments in New York and Paris, so she’s not short of other places to stay.
